Modern 3BR/3BA Boone Cabin: Hot Tub, Game Room, Porch, Near Trails and Downtown
Escape to this cozy 3-bedroom, 3-bath cabin nestled in the mountains of Boone in Western North Carolina, your perfect basecamp for year-round adventure or peaceful relaxation in the High Country. Whether you're seeking an outdoor getaway, a family-friendly retreat, or a quiet place to recharge, this charming home blends rustic comfort with modern amenities in a convenient location.
Just 10 minutes from downtown Boone and close to top regional attractions, the cabin is a short drive from Rocky Knob Mountain Biking Park, hiking trails along the Blue Ridge Parkway, fly fishing or tubing on the New River, and local favorites like Booneshine Brewery and Bald Guy Brew. You’ll also be within easy reach of Grandfather Mountain’s Mile High Swinging Bridge, ski resorts, scenic drives, zipline courses, and family fun at Tweetsie Railroad.
The home features two queen bedrooms and one full bedroom, ideal for families, couples, or small groups. The upstairs living room is warm and inviting with cozy furnishings, a flat-screen smart TV, and a Bluetooth sound bar with subwoofer—perfect for movie nights or playing music. High-speed WiFi makes it easy to stream or stay connected. The kitchen is fully stocked for home-cooked meals, and the dining area offers a welcoming space to gather. You’ll also enjoy the comfort of central heating and air conditioning, plus a washer and dryer for added convenience.
Downstairs, a large family/game room gives guests even more space to spread out and unwind. This bonus living area includes a second smart TV, a sectional sofa, a full-size ping pong table, and a dart board for rainy days, evening fun, or keeping kids entertained while adults relax upstairs.
After a day of adventure, soak in the private hot tub or relax on the deck with your favorite beverage. The outdoor space includes a charcoal grill, seating area, and peaceful wooded views, perfect for morning coffee or post-hike lounging. The driveway offers easy access and free parking for multiple vehicles, and check-in is a breeze with a keyless smart lock.
Whether you're hiking, biking, skiing, ziplining, or exploring nearby towns like Blowing Rock and Banner Elk, this well-located retreat provides the right balance of seclusion and access. It’s also a great home base for visitors to Appalachian State University, seasonal festivals, or simply unplugging for the weekend.
This cabin isn’t just a place to stay; it’s a place to feel at home in the mountains.
